Within cellular networks, which consequence results when excessive signal delay spread occurs?

A)Equalization algorithm processing failures
B)Reduced power amplifier efficiency
C)Increased backscatter cross-section
D)Elevated thermal noise floor

💡 Explanation

Excessive signal delay spread causes intersymbol interference, as later symbols overlap with earlier ones, because the multipath arrival times are beyond the cyclic prefix; therefore equalization algorithm processing failures escalate, rather than power inefficiency, backscatter changes, or noise increase being the primary results.
